Transaction 5e685585236ec95db2f714164fa568656fa9e58b98c9b3166355cb8088a0be08

1 Input
2 Outputs
  • 5e685585236ec95db2f714164fa568656fa9e58b98c9b3166355cb8088a0be08:0
  • value  6584
    address  1ErWhMDtCyFb9ogC99zRkVpDpogQUJbwYg
  • 5e685585236ec95db2f714164fa568656fa9e58b98c9b3166355cb8088a0be08:1
  • value  2143559
    address  1JMSmMxi2uZHv4Ep2UV8PDXoV52Txh55zG